首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MySQL sql_cache缓存使用

Query Cache相关参数: query_cache_size QC占用空间大小,通过将其设置为0关闭QC功能 query_cache_type 0表示关闭QC;1表示正常缓存;2表示SQL_CACHE...在缓存中直接得到结果,不需要再去解析 have_query_cache          –查询缓存是否可用 query_cache_limit           –可缓存具体查询结果的最大值 query_cache_size...           –查询缓存的大小 query_cache_type           –阻止或是支持查询缓存 set global query_cache_size = 600000; –设置缓存内存...select速度的地方,使用: SELECT SQL_CACHE * FROM… 【mysql cache调试笔记】 1 可以使用下列命令开启mysql的select cache功能: SET GLOBAL query_cache_size...= 102400000; 因为当query_cache_size默认为0时,是不开启cache功能的。

59660
您找到你想要的搜索结果了吗?
是的
没有找到

MySQL数据库:参数优化

本文先从 MySQL 数据库IO相关缓存参数的角度来介绍可以通过哪些参数进行IO优化: 一、参数说明: 1、query_cache_size / query_cache_type (global): Query...Query Cache的使用需要多个参数配合,其中最为关键的是 query_cache_size 和 query_cache_type,前者设置用于缓存 ResultSet 的内存大小,后者设置在何场景下使用...(1)query_cache_size:用于缓存的大小: 在以往的经验来看,如果不是用来缓存基本不变的数据的MySQL数据库,query_cache_size 一般 256MB 是一个比较合适的大小。...下面是几个参数的建议取值: query_cache_type : 如果全部使用innodb存储引擎,建议为0,如果使用MyISAM 存储引擎,建议为2,同时在SQL语句中显式控制是否是使用query cache; query_cache_size

1.4K10

傻瓜MySQL查询缓存都不知道...

query_cache_size 查询缓存大小,单位Bytes,设置为0是禁用QueryCache,注意:不要将缓存的大小设置得太大,由于在更新过程中需要线程锁定QueryCache,因此对于非常大的缓存...query_cache_type 当query_cache_size>0;该变量影响qc如何工作,有三个取值0,1,2,0:禁止缓存或检索缓存结果;1:启用缓存,SELECT SQL_NO_CACHE的语句除外...[mysqld] query_cache_size = 32M query_cache_type = 1 QueryCache使用 先搞点测试数据,分别对禁用和开启QueryCache下的场景进行测试...#禁用QueryCache的配置 query_cache_size = 0 query_cache_type = 0 重复执行下面查询,观察执行时间。...#禁用QueryCache的配置 query_cache_size = 32M query_cache_type = 1 --第一次执行查询语句 mysql> select * from users

75120
领券